数据安全与隐私保护在大数据处理中的应用
发布时间: 2024-01-17 09:47:42 阅读量: 17 订阅数: 11
# 1. 引言
## 1.1 大数据处理的背景与意义
随着互联网和信息技术的快速发展,大数据成为当今社会的重要资源之一。大数据的处理和分析能够帮助企业和组织发现潜在的商机和趋势,优化决策和运营策略,推动创新和发展。然而,随着大数据的广泛应用,数据安全和隐私保护问题也日益凸显起来。大量敏感数据的收集、存储与处理给用户和组织的隐私带来了巨大的风险,如何在大数据处理中保障数据的安全与隐私成为亟待解决的问题。
## 1.2 数据安全与隐私保护的重要性
数据安全和隐私保护是信息技术领域的重要议题之一。在大数据时代,传统的数据安全和隐私保护手段已经不再适用,因为大数据的特点决定了其处理规模庞大、数据源多样、数据流动频繁。因此,独特的大数据隐私保护技术和策略成为保护用户和组织数据安全的关键。隐私泄露不仅可能导致个人信息被滥用,还可能对个人、组织和社会造成严重的经济和社会风险。因此,加强大数据隐私保护对于维护公民权益、促进信息技术的良性发展具有重要意义。
## 1.3 本文结构概览
本文主要介绍数据安全与隐私保护在大数据处理中的应用。首先,将综述大数据隐私保护技术,包括数据加密技术、匿名化与脱敏技术、访问控制与认证技术等。然后,将探讨大数据隐私检测与分析方法,包括隐私泄露检测技术、隐私分析与风险评估等。接着,将通过实践案例介绍大数据安全与隐私保护在金融、医疗健康和电子商务领域的具体应用。最后,将展望未来大数据安全与隐私保护的挑战与发展趋势,并给出结论和建议。
希望本章内容对您有所帮助!接下来,我们将继续完成文章的其他章节。
# 2. 大数据隐私保护技术综述
在大数据处理过程中,数据安全与隐私保护是非常重要的问题。本章将综述大数据隐私保护技术的一些主要方法和工具。
## 2.1 数据加密技术在大数据处理中的应用
数据加密是目前最常用的数据安全技术之一,它通过将原始数据转化为密文来保护数据的安全性。在大数据处理中,数据加密可以应用于多个环节,包括数据传输、数据存储和数据计算等。
在数据传输方面,可以使用传输层安全协议(TLS)或者虚拟专用网络(VPN)等技术,对数据进行端到端加密,确保数据在传输过程中不会被窃取或篡改。
在数据存储方面,可以采用各种加密算法对数据进行加密操作。常见的加密算法包括对称加密算法(如AES)和非对称加密算法(如RSA)。对称加密使用相同的密钥进行加密和解密,通常用于对数据块进行加密。非对称加密使用一对密钥(公钥和私钥),公钥用于加密数据,私钥用于解密数据,常用于加密密钥的传输。
在数据计算方面,可以采用同态加密等技术对数据进行加密处理,实现在加密数据上进行计算而不需要解密数据。同态加密可以保证在加密状态下进行加法或乘法等操作,得到的结果仍然是加密的,只有在解密之后才能获取明文结果。
## 2.2 匿名化与脱敏技术在大数据隐私保护中的作用
匿名化与脱敏技术是常用的隐私保护手段,通过对敏感数据进行处理,去除个人或敏感信息,从而降低数据泄露的风险。
匿名化技术主要包括基于数据泛化和数据扰动的方法。数据泛化通过对原始数据进行一定程度的模糊化处理,去除个人身份信息,如将精确的年龄改为年龄段,将精确的位置改为地理区域等。数据扰动则是在原始数据上添加噪声或进行数据重组,使得攻击者难以通过分析推断出敏感信息。
脱敏技术则是采用替换或删除敏感信息的方式来保护数据隐私。常见的脱敏方法包括数据加密脱敏、数据删除脱敏和数据替换脱敏等。数据加密脱敏通过对敏感数据进行加密操作,只有授权人员才能解密获取明文数据。数据删除脱敏则是将敏感数据进行彻底的删除,不再存储在系统中。数据替换脱敏则是将敏感数据替换为虚拟值,以保护数据隐私。
## 2.3 访问控制与认证技术在大数据安全中的应用
访问控制与认证技术是实现大数据安全的重要手段。访问控制技术通过对用户的访问进行授权和限制,确保只有经过授权的用户可以访问数据资源。认证技术则是对用户进行身份验证,确保用户的真实身份。
在大数据处理中,常见的访问控制技术包括基于角色的访问控制(RB
0
0